## Approvals: BigDiff Viewer

Heads up for security review: the BigDiff viewer in Quillstone now streams diffs for files over 200 MB instead of loading them into memory. It never writes temp copies to shared disk, and redacted hunks stay redacted in the rendered view. Any change to the chunking or redaction logic needs a fresh approval before merge — no exceptions, even for hotfixes. All approvals route through one owner.

named custodian: Brivan Eliath Quenox Frador

## Releases

Quick note for the sync: the nightly search reindex on Mossgate now ships as its own release artifact instead of piggybacking on the API deploy. It runs at 01:30, takes ~20 minutes, and rolls back automatically on checksum mismatch. Artifacts must be signed before the runner will touch them. The key we sign reindex artifacts with is below.

release key, bagep-yajof: bky19_xtqFhCW5hRYj5CXT2ZJ

- [ ] **Landlord audit walkthrough (Day 1, 10:00).** Greenhalgh Property, the landlord for Marwick House, conducts its annual site audit on your first day. As a visiting contractor you must sign the audit attendance sheet at the hut, wear high-visibility clothing in all service corridors, and stay with your assigned escort from Dunmore Fit-Out. Photography is prohibited during the audit. Access to the plant room is via the rear stair only; the keypad there requires the code below.

door code, bagef-yafop: bdg-ZFZML-07646

## Fareprobe Environments

Fareprobe runs the ticket-pricing experiment in sandbox and prod only. Sandbox uses synthetic rider data; prod samples 2% of live traffic. Experiment flags are toggled via the control plane, never in code. Access to prod toggles is restricted to the pricing group. The prod service starts with the following configuration.

settings of bafof-fajog:
[aldix]
port = 9300
region = north-3
host = aldix.kelvilabs.example
team = istath
timeout_ms = 1500
retries = 8